Output 66f8c0aa064f608fe86734215b227471dd4358c84bbf182cf065c3ef07fb8276:3

value
21180000
script pubkey
OP_HASH160 OP_PUSHBYTES_20 cc6cf269fa37430e49c40a749a2c462740faf7c0 OP_EQUAL
address
3LKvHScwMUqnkGR2Bz2pRi9T4N9GV3zcnw
transaction
66f8c0aa064f608fe86734215b227471dd4358c84bbf182cf065c3ef07fb8276
confirmations
402131
spent
true